Ralph, On the ompi-release repo, developers with no write permissions (e.g. all but RM, GK and admin) cannot set label nor milestone nor assign PR. The bot was a creative way to work around this limitation. IIRC, the bot does not accept instructions from non Open MPI developers.
The new "review" feature can be a replacement of the bot interpreting thumbs up/down. I had no time me to check the unified repo, so I did not check who can set label/milestone/assignment and review PR vs the release branches. If developer can do that, then the bot is no more necessary. That being said, I am happy to keep help maintaining it for those, including myself, that are more comfortable with typing text rather than clicking a web interface. Cheers, Gilles On Tuesday, September 20, 2016, r...@open-mpi.org <r...@open-mpi.org> wrote: > One question, to be discussed on the webex: now that github has a > “reviewed” feature, so we still need/want the “thumbs-up” bot? If we retain > it, then how do we deal with the non-sync’d, duplicative mechanisms? > > > On Sep 19, 2016, at 4:23 PM, George Bosilca <bosi...@icl.utk.edu > <javascript:_e(%7B%7D,'cvml','bosi...@icl.utk.edu');>> wrote: > > :+1: > > George. > > > On Mon, Sep 19, 2016 at 6:56 PM, Jeff Squyres (jsquyres) < > jsquy...@cisco.com <javascript:_e(%7B%7D,'cvml','jsquy...@cisco.com');>> > wrote: > >> (we can discuss all of this on the Webex tomorrow) >> >> Here's a sample repo where I merged ompi and ompi-release: >> >> https://github.com/open-mpi/ompi-all-the-branches >> >> Please compare it to: >> >> https://github.com/open-mpi/ompi >> and https://github.com/open-mpi/ompi-release >> >> It's current to as of within the last hour or so. >> >> Feel free to make dummy commits / pull requests on this rep. It's a >> sandbox repo that will eventually be deleted; it's safe to make whatever >> changes you want on this repo. >> >> Notes: >> >> - All current OMPI developers have been given the same push/merge access >> on master >> - Force pushes are disabled on *all* branches >> - On release branches: >> - Pull requests cannot be merged without at least 1 review >> *** ^^^ This is a new Github feature >> - Only the gatekeeper team can merge PRs >> >> If no one sees any problem with this sandbox repo, I can merge all the >> ompi-release branches to the ompi repo as soon as tomorrow, and config the >> same settings. >> >> -- >> Jeff Squyres >> jsquy...@cisco.com <javascript:_e(%7B%7D,'cvml','jsquy...@cisco.com');> >> For corporate legal information go to: http://www.cisco.com/web/about >> /doing_business/legal/cri/ >> >> _______________________________________________ >> devel mailing list >> devel@lists.open-mpi.org >> <javascript:_e(%7B%7D,'cvml','devel@lists.open-mpi.org');> >> https://rfd.newmexicoconsortium.org/mailman/listinfo/devel >> > > _______________________________________________ > devel mailing list > devel@lists.open-mpi.org > <javascript:_e(%7B%7D,'cvml','devel@lists.open-mpi.org');> > https://rfd.newmexicoconsortium.org/mailman/listinfo/devel > > >
_______________________________________________ devel mailing list devel@lists.open-mpi.org https://rfd.newmexicoconsortium.org/mailman/listinfo/devel